Phachar Solanki
Phachar Solanki is a village located in Nimbahera tehsil of Chittaurgarh district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 23km away from sub-district headquarter Nimbahera (tehsildar office) and 19km away from district headquarter Chittaurgarh. As per 2009 stats, Ukhaliya is the gram panchayat of Phachar Solanki village.

About Phachar Solanki
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Phachar Solanki is 101345. The village spans a total geographical area of 283 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 312620. Chittaurgarh is nearest town to Phachar Solanki village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 19km away.

Population of Phachar Solanki
According to the 2011 Census, Phachar Solanki has a total population of about 567, with approximately 292 males and 275 females. The sex ratio is around 941 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 67 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 40 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 41. The overall literacy rate is approximately 58.55%, with male literacy at about 71.58% and female literacy near 44.73%. There are around 108 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 567 | 292 | 275 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 67 | 37 | 30 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 40 | 22 | 18 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 41 | 21 | 20 |
Literate Population | 332 | 209 | 123 |
Illiterate Population | 235 | 83 | 152 |
Connectivity of Phachar Solanki
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Phachar Solanki. As per the 2011 stats, Phachar Solanki had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
